// formatUptime renders a duration as a compact human-readable string such as
// "45s", "3m12s", "1h04m", or "2d03h". Negative durations are clamped to zero.
// The largest two units are shown so the value stays short at any scale.
func formatUptime(d time.Duration) string {
if d < 0 {
d = 0
}
totalSeconds := int64(d / time.Second)
days := totalSeconds / 86400
hours := (totalSeconds % 86400) / 3600
minutes := (totalSeconds % 3600) / 60
seconds := totalSeconds % 60

switch {
case days > 0:
return fmt.Sprintf("%dd%02dh", days, hours)
case hours > 0:
return fmt.Sprintf("%dh%02dm", hours, minutes)
case minutes > 0:
return fmt.Sprintf("%dm%02ds", minutes, seconds)
default:
return fmt.Sprintf("%ds", seconds)
}
}

func TestFormatUptime(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
in time.Duration
want string
}{
{"negative clamps to zero", -5 * time.Second, "0s"},
{"seconds only", 45 * time.Second, "45s"},
{"minutes and seconds", 3*time.Minute + 12*time.Second, "3m12s"},
{"pads seconds", 3*time.Minute + 2*time.Second, "3m02s"},
{"hours and minutes drop seconds", time.Hour + 4*time.Minute + 9*time.Second, "1h04m"},
{"days and hours", 2*24*time.Hour + 3*time.Hour + 30*time.Minute, "2d03h"},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
assert.Equal(t, tt.want, formatUptime(tt.in))
})
}
}
